اطلاعیه

Collapse
No announcement yet.

چگونگی پروگرام کردن میکروکنترلر 89s51

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    چگونگی پروگرام کردن میکروکنترلر 89s51

    دوستان برای پروگرم کردن 89S51 باید رو چه مداری و با چه برنامه ای پروگرم کرد؟
    در ضمن یه سوال داشتم که آیا می شه چند بار اطلاعات رو از رو میکروکنترلر حذف کرد و دوباره توش ریخت؟
    کنکوری 90 ديروز،آ‌دانشجو مهندسي نرم افزار پلي تكنيك امروز!

    #2
    پ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

    نوشته اصلی توسط vahid-elect
    دوستان برای پروگرم کردن 89S51 باید رو چه مداری و با چه برنامه ای پروگرم کرد؟
    در ضمن یه سوال داشتم که آیا می شه چند بار اطلاعات رو از رو میکروکنترلر حذف کرد و دوباره توش ریخت؟
    با سلام

    ساده ترین سخت افزار مورد نیاز برای پروگرامینگ این میکرو ، استفاده از یک 74ال اس 244 و چند مقاومت و خازن و کانکتوره .

    دیدگاه


      #3
      پ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

      ساده ترین سخت افزار مورد نیاز برای پروگرامینگ این میکرو ، استفاده از یک 74ال اس 244 و چند مقاومت و خازن و کانکتوره .
      خوب دوست عزیز منظورم همون شما تیک مدار هستش و برنامه ای که می شه فایلها رو انتقال داد.
      و سوالی که داشتم رو لطفا اگه می شه جواب بدید.
      کنکوری 90 ديروز،آ‌دانشجو مهندسي نرم افزار پلي تكنيك امروز!

      دیدگاه


        #4
        پ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

        سلام
        این مداری که دوستان می گن خیلی راحت هست ولی بهترین نیست
        AT89S51, AT89S52, AT89S53, AT89S8253, AT89S2051, AT89S4051, AVR family
        (Tested on the AT89S52 and ATMEGA16L)

        [url=http://[url=http://www.ikalogic.com/isp.phpاینم سایت اصلی][url]اینم سایت اصلی]http://www.ikalogic.com/isp.phpاینم سایت اصلی]
        یکی دیگه توی همین سایت گذاشتم که خودم ساختم و تمامی سری خانواده 8051 ساپورت می گرد خودم هم ساخته بودم و خیلی خوب بود
        در ضمن می تونید اصلا آی سی بافر استفاده نکنید که خطر ناکه و لی به جای اون آی سی می تونید بافر معمولی مثل 74244 استفاده کنید
        موفق باشید

        دیدگاه


          #5
          پ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

          سلام دوست عزیز

          لینک پروگرمری که شما میخواین رو قبلا تو این پست گذاشته بودم .

          http://www.eca.ir/forum2/index.php/topic,11365.msg49485.html#msg49485

          اگه سرچ میکردی حتما پیدا میکردی.
          الان لینک اون پست رو براتون گذاشتم توضیحات هم تو همون پست هستش بازم اگه سوالی داشتین . بپرسین


          موفق باشید .
          دوش دیوانه شدم عشق مرا دید و بگفت آمدم نعره مزن جامه مدر هیچ مگو
          گفتم ای عشق من از چیز دگر می​ترسم گفت آن چیز دگر نیست دگر هیچ مگو
          من به گوش تو سخن​های نهان خواهم گفت سر بجنبان که بلی جز که به سر هیچ مگو
          قمری جان صفتی در ره دل پیدا شد در ره دل چه لطیف است سفر هیچ مگو
          مولانا

          دیدگاه


            #6
            پ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

            من هم روش ساخت کابل ISP رو اینجا توضیح دادم:

            http://www.avr.ir/index.php?option=com_content&task=view&id= 26&Itemid=27

            There is nothing so practical as a good theory. — Kurt Lewin, 1951

            دیدگاه


              #7
              پ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

              یکی دیگه توی همین سایت گذاشتم که خودم ساختم و تمامی سری خانواده 8051 ساپورت می گرد خودم هم ساخته بودم و خیلی خوب بود
              در ضمن می تونید اصلا آی سی بافر استفاده نکنید که خطر ناکه و لی به جای اون آی سی می تونید بافر معمولی مثل 74244 استفاده کنید
              موفق باشید
              چرا ای سی بافر خطرناکه ؟

              سلام دوست عزیز

              لینک پروگرمری که شما میخواین رو قبلا تو این پست گذاشته بودم .

              http://www.eca.ir/forum2/index.php/topic,11365.msg49485.html#msg49485

              اگه سرچ میکردی حتما پیدا میکردی.
              الان لینک اون پست رو براتون گذاشتم توضیحات هم تو همون پست هستش بازم اگه سوالی داشتین . بپرسین
              دقیقا این رو پیدا کردم ولی خیلی از دوستان تو پست های دیگه گفته بودن که کار نمی کنه.



              اگه می شه ساده ترین مدار رو با کمترین قطعات رو بنویسید.اگر می شه در مدار از ای سی استفاده نشه.
              در ضمن اگه می شه به این سوالی که پرسیدم جواب بدید.
              در ضمن یه سوال داشتم که آیا می شه چند بار اطلاعات رو از رو میکروکنترلر حذف کرد و دوباره توش ریخت؟
              کنکوری 90 ديروز،آ‌دانشجو مهندسي نرم افزار پلي تكنيك امروز!

              دیدگاه


                #8
                پ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                نوشته اصلی توسط shockley
                من هم روش ساخت کابل ISP رو اینجا توضیح دادم:

                http://www.avr.ir/index.php?option=com_content&task=view&id= 26&Itemid=27

                این مطلبتون رو دیدم و جالب بود( تشکر ) . اما 5 ولت و کریستال 24MHz رو توضیح ندادید که کجا باید وصل بشه. و در ضمن اگه میشه بگید کریستال چیه و چکاری انجام می ده. دضمن اگه می شه توضیح بدید چکار کنم که احتمال سوختن میکرو کنترلر از بین بره ( اتصال کوتاه ) ؟
                اگه این ها رو توضیح بدید فکر کنم دیگه مشکلی نباشه چون اتصال میکروکنترلر با پورت پرینتر که خیلی راحته.
                کنکوری 90 ديروز،آ‌دانشجو مهندسي نرم افزار پلي تكنيك امروز!

                دیدگاه


                  #9
                  پ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                  1-فهمیدم کریستال چیه. ( کر یستالی پیدا کردم E A 17.734475 ) فکر کنم باید به پایه های 18 و 19 متصل بشه، درسته ؟
                  2- 5 ولت رو باید کجا متصل کنم؟
                  3- اگه اتصال کوتاه پیدا بشه ، میکروکنترلر می سوزه؟ چه می شه کرد تا نسوره؟
                  کنکوری 90 ديروز،آ‌دانشجو مهندسي نرم افزار پلي تكنيك امروز!

                  دیدگاه


                    #10
                    پ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                    سلام
                    من گفتم بدون بافر خطر ناکه ولی اگه مواظب باشید که پورت lpt اتصالی نکنه که باعث سوختن اون می شه مهم نیست من خودم برای avr بدون بافره و مستقیم وصل می کنم

                    دیدگاه


                      #11
                      پ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                      نوشته اصلی توسط vahid-elect
                      ساده ترین سخت افزار مورد نیاز برای پروگرامینگ این میکرو ، استفاده از یک 74ال اس 244 و چند مقاومت و خازن و کانکتوره .
                      خوب دوست عزیز منظورم همون شما تیک مدار هستش و برنامه ای که می شه فایلها رو انتقال داد.
                      و سوالی که داشتم رو لطفا اگه می شه جواب بدید.
                      با سلام

                      از این مدار میتونید استفاده کنید

                      http://www.kmitl.ac.th/~kswichit/ISP-Pgm3v0/ISP-Pgm3v0.html
                      http://www.btc.pl/pdf/zl9prg.pdf
                      http://www.atmel.com/dyn/resources/prod_documents/doc3310.pdf
                      ولی مناسبترین نرم افزار ، برای پروگرامینگ سری 89sxx ، این میباشد .
                      http://www.atmel.com/dyn/products/tools_card.asp?tool_id=2877

                      دیدگاه


                        #12
                        پ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                        من گفتم بدون بافر خطر ناکه ولی اگه مواظب باشید که پورت lpt اتصالی نکنه که باعث سوختن اون می شه مهم نیست من خودم برای avr بدون بافره و مستقیم وصل می کنم
                        ببخشید منظورتون رو اشتباهی فهمیدم. فقط یه توضیحی در مورد مدارتون ( با بافر) بدید که مقاومت باید چقدر باشه و فکر کنم دیگه توضیحی نمونده باشه؟ اگه یکم توضیح بیشتر بدید ممنون می شم.

                        http://www.kmitl.ac.th/~kswichit/ISP-Pgm3v0/ISP-Pgm3v0.html
                        http://www.btc.pl/pdf/zl9prg.pdf
                        http://www.atmel.com/dyn/resources/prod_documents/doc3310.pdf
                        ولی مناسبترین نرم افزار ، برای پروگرامینگ سری 89sxx ، این میباشد .
                        http://www.atmel.com/dyn/products/tools_card.asp?tool_id=2877
                        این ها که مدرات مشکلی دارن.
                        کنکوری 90 ديروز،آ‌دانشجو مهندسي نرم افزار پلي تكنيك امروز!

                        دیدگاه


                          #13
                          پ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                          توضیح خاصی نداره می تونید از همین آی سی استفاده شده استفاده کنید و یا یک مقاومت 560 اهم سر هر پین lpt که استفاده شده بذارین و بافر نمی خواد

                          دیدگاه


                            #14
                            پ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                            سلام


                            سلام دوست عزیز

                            لینک پروگرمری که شما میخواین رو قبلا تو این پست گذاشته بودم .

                            http://www.eca.ir/forum2/index.php/topic,11365.msg49485.html#msg49485

                            اگه سرچ میکردی حتما پیدا میکردی.
                            الان لینک اون پست رو براتون گذاشتم توضیحات هم تو همون پست هستش بازم اگه سوالی داشتین . بپرسین
                            دقیقا این رو پیدا کردم ولی خیلی از دوستان تو پست های دیگه گفته بودن که کار نمی کنه.
                            من همینو ساختم و باهاش کار کردم . مشکلی هم نداشتم :question:

                            تو اون تاپیکی هم که لینک دادم کسی نگفته بود که کار نمیکنه :question: :question: :question: :question: :question:
                            دوش دیوانه شدم عشق مرا دید و بگفت آمدم نعره مزن جامه مدر هیچ مگو
                            گفتم ای عشق من از چیز دگر می​ترسم گفت آن چیز دگر نیست دگر هیچ مگو
                            من به گوش تو سخن​های نهان خواهم گفت سر بجنبان که بلی جز که به سر هیچ مگو
                            قمری جان صفتی در ره دل پیدا شد در ره دل چه لطیف است سفر هیچ مگو
                            مولانا

                            دیدگاه


                              #15
                              پاسخ : چگونگی پروگرام کردن میکروکنترلر 89s51

                              توضیح خاصی نداره می تونید از همین آی سی استفاده شده استفاده کنید و یا یک مقاومت 560 اهم سر هر پین lpt که استفاده شده بذارین و بافر نمی خواد
                              خیلی ممنون . اگه با مقاومت می شه که چه بهتر. ولی سوال اصلی من این بود که 5 ولت + و - رو باید چطوری ببندم.یعنی رو کدوم پایه های میکروکنترلر 89S51 ؟

                              من همینو ساختم و باهاش کار کردم . مشکلی هم نداشتم

                              تو اون تاپیکی هم که لینک دادم کسی نگفته بود که کار نمیکنه
                              من که نگفتم تو همون تاپیک ، گفتم تو تاپیک های دیگه و هر کدوم می گفتند در کل مدار آسونی برای پروگرام کردن نیست. باز هم ممنونم چون دیگران می تونن ازش استفاده کنن. :applause:
                              کنکوری 90 ديروز،آ‌دانشجو مهندسي نرم افزار پلي تكنيك امروز!

                              دیدگاه

                              لطفا صبر کنید...
                              X